The Oliver Twist crooner has reached out to his lawyers who are ready for a case with Miss Babatayo. The pre-litigation letter was signed by his lawyer, Chief Mike Ozekhome (SAN). D’banj asked his accuser to make a payment of N100m within 48 hours or face legal action.

The letter also demanded an apology to be published in at least four national dailies. The letter was addressed to Miss Babatayo’s lawyer, Ojoge, Omileye and Partners, dated June 15, 2020.
Here is a list of the details of the letter.
First and foremost, an outright apology and a total retraction of each and every false allegation made against and concerning our client.

Secondly, the said apology and retraction shall be published in four national dailies. It will also be published on social media platforms and handles being used by your client and her hirelings.

Thirdly, your client makes a compensatory deposit of the sum of N100m. This shall be done only through this chambers in favour of our client to assuage his battered image.

In addition, D’banj stated that his accuser was only a gold digger. She was on a mission to destroy the reputation he had built for nearly two decades in the music industry.

The musician said he was married when the purported rape took place. Moreso, the allegation was an insult to his wife.

Miss Babatayo took to social media to call out the star in the same period Uwa Vera was raped. Uwa Vera was a student of University of Benin. She was raped while reading in her church in Benin.

Nevertheless, D’banj is all out to clear his name and defend himself. The former Mo’Hits Records star has the backing of his lawyers.

CelebritiesBbnaija’s Khaffi Kareem Looses Brother To Gun Shots by Cuterboy(op): 1:54am On Jun 14, 2020
It’s a day of tragedy for BBNaija’s Kaffi Kareem as she looses younger brother, Alexander Kareem to gun shot wounds.
Khaffi first broke the sad news on her daily #KhafiPrays YouTube channel. She posted a black photo with the caption 00:40 and a heartbreak emoji. Although she seems not ready to talk about what really happened in details, she wants everyone to rember her family in prayers

In a recent BBC broadcast, her 20-year-old brother was shot dead close to their family home in Shepherd’s Bush, West London. Alexander died after suffering gunshot wounds to his chest and abdomen on Askew Road in Shepherd’s Bush at 00.40 AM on Monday.

Barely three months ago, Khaffi celebrated her brother’s birthday with love from the bottom of her heart. It is rather unfortunate that young Alexander lost his life to a trigger happy individual who is still at large.

PoliticsAll Progressives Congress Appeal Committee Upholds Obaseki’s Disqualification by Cuterboy(op): 12:41am On Jun 14, 2020
All Progressives Congress committee has upheld Godwin Obaseki’s disqualification. It was upheld by the Screening Appeal Committee of the All Progressives Congress.

The appeal committee presented its report to the National Working Committee headed by Adams Oshiomhole on Saturday.

Dr Abubakar Fari led the committee. He cited discrepancies in the dates on Obaseki’s University of Ibadan certificate.

Fari said it is incredible that the same University will award two certificates with separate dates for the same graduate.

He stated that it is difficult to vouch for the authenticity of Obaseki’s National Youth Service Corps certificate. This is because where he served was not indicated. For that, they uphold his disqualification.

TV/MoviesNetflix Partners With Ebonylife To Adapt Soyinka Books Into Movies by Cuterboy(op):
Netflix partners with Ebonylife to adapt Soyinka and Shoneyin’s books into movies.
Netflix and Nigerian media entrepreneur, Mo Abudu enters into a partnership. This will therefore see to the continual growth of the company’s investment in Nigerian content.

Netflix and Mo Abudu‘s partnership will see to the movie adaptation of two books. Prominent Nigerian authors Wole Soyinka and Lola Shoneyin are the authors of the books.

Lola Shoneyin’s “The Secret Lives of Baba Segi’s Wives” will be acted as a series. Also, Wole Soyinka’s “Death And The King’s Horseman” will get a film adaptation.

The American media-services provider said the film adaptation of “Death And The King’s Horseman” will be among the newly-licensed Netflix branded films. One of the films will premiere on the service in 2020.

Furthermore, details on the two original series and the slated date of the Netflix-branded projects will be shared later.

BusinessPepsi’s $32 Billion Typo Caused Deadly Riots - Important Lesson Learnt by Cuterboy(op): 12:33am On Jun 13, 2020
@ https://9jababa.com

Did Pepsi accidentally make a promise they couldn’t keep?
It started a year prior.
Pepsi was trying to break into the Philippine market where Coca-Cola was already dominant. This was the 12th largest soft drink market, with a rapidly growing population of 62 million people.
The economy was weak. Lots of people struggling to make ends meet. Tens of millions worked in rice fields and other physically demanding, low paying jobs.

Pepsi executives decided to do a promotional campaign that promised to have lots of payouts. Each Pepsi bottle cap would have a number that correlated to a prize that would be announced. There were be lots of small winners and then two huge winners of $40,000 each.

One Massive, Massive Problem
Pepsi hoped the allure of prize money would convert many of the low-income Coke drinkers. They strategically planned to give out a total of $2M in prizes.
However, a computer glitch with one of Pepsi’s vendors caused them to manufacture 800,000 bottles with the number “349” on the bottle cap.
The number “349” was the $40,000 winning number.
Pepsi had explicitly told its vendor factories not to print this number at all. The two bottles with that number would be specially manufactured and sent to the Philippines by Pepsi themselves.
So here is Pepsi, churning along each month, not knowing they accidentally sent $32 billion worth of winning caps to the Philippines. Meanwhile, everyone in the Philippines is going bananas for this promotion, buying up all the soda bottles. This disruptive campaign increased Pepsi’s market share from 4% to 24.9% in just two months.
Fast Forward. The big day arrives. All the Filipinos have their TV’s on. Pepsi goes on to announce the winning bottlecap number, 349, and across the Philippines, crowds of people are cheering. They’ve won enough money to buy a large house.
Pepsi then realizes they’ve made a terrible mistake. They do their whole, “Whoa whoa whoa, hold up.”
The optics of the situation aren’t pretty. You have this first world multibillion-dollar business that has made this huge monetary promise to these poor people, only to backpedal and blame it on a system error. One could see how it wouldn’t sit well with a rice farmer.
Pepsi realizes they can’t just walk away without paying anything. They make an offer of $18 to each patron. It came out to $8.7M in total payouts, versus their original budget of $2M. The people don’t find this offer very appetizing.
A 349 Alliance consumer action group forms. They begin protesting across Manila, in front of government buildings as well as Pepsi’s local headquarters.
Things start to get more violent. Then, full-blown riots break out. More than 30 Pepsi trucks are firebombed in the process.
Then the situation escalates even more. Police are called in and rioters begin fighting with them, throwing rocks.
The fighting continues on throughout the day. By the end of all the carnage, five people die and dozens more are wounded. All because of a marketing promotion went wrong.
Following all of this, Pepsi faced thousands of court claims that it had to work through in the following years. There was a lengthy trial and the Philippine commerce courts eventually ruled that Pepsi’s mistake wasn’t malicious and it hadn’t committed a crime.
At the end of everything, Pepsi’s total combined losses, between physical, legal, and brand equity costs, would top $20M. Their market share would plummet and take years to rebound.
But Pepsi, ever the resilient brand, would recover its market share in due time. But not before “revisiting” a few of their internal processes.

CelebritiesSix Years After Her Death, Nigerians Remember Gospel Singer Kefee by Cuterboy(op): 6:57pm On Jun 12, 2020
Six years after her death, Nigerians remember gospel singer Kefee. Kefee Obareki was a gospel singer who thrilled Nigerians and her other fans in diaspora with her melodious voice.

Nigerians remember gospel singer Kefee for her love for making gospel songs a delight to listen to. Both Christians and non Christians loved her songs.


She was born on February 5, 1980 in Sapele Delta. The gospel singer was part of her church choir. She moved on to sign a contract with Alec’s Entertainment. Alec’s Entertainment was owned by her first husband Alecs Godwin.

During her spell with Alec music, she released many songs. Branama was one of her leading songs that made the airwaves. The gospel singer also released songs like Akpo, Sapele water, Igbunu, and many others.

Kefee divorced Alecs Godwin and married Don Momoh, an On Air Personality who also doubled as her manager. The gospel singer went on to release songs like Kokoroko which became a hit in 2009. She featured Timaya on it. The song...
